Oyakodon (Chicken & Egg Rice Bowl)

親子丼

Ingredients

200g chicken thigh 1 onion 2 eggs 1 cup dashi 2 tbsp soy sauce 1 tbsp mirin 1 tbsp sugar 2 servings cooked rice mitsuba or green onion

Detail Steps and Procedure

1. **Broth Simmering:** Combine dashi, soy sauce, mirin, sugar in pan. Bring to simmer over medium heat (85°C/185°F). Add thinly sliced onion, cook 3 minutes. [PREP: Slice onion 3mm thick, cut chicken into 2cm bite-sized pieces]

2. **Cooking Chicken:** Add chicken to pan in single layer. Simmer 5 minutes at 82°C/180°F until chicken is cooked through. [CRITICAL: Maintain gentle simmer – boiling toughens chicken]

3. **Egg Addition:** Lightly beat eggs (leave some streaks). Pour ⅔ over chicken. Cover, cook 1 minute until egg is 70% set. Add remaining egg, cover, turn off heat. Residual heat cooks eggs to perfect doneness in 45 seconds. [TECHNIQUE: Two-stage egg addition creates layered texture]

4. **Assembly:** Divide hot rice into bowls. Slide chicken-egg mixture over rice. [SERVE: Immediately while eggs are creamy. Garnish with mitsuba. STORE: Not recommended – consume immediately.]
